    As Christians we are to be a reflection of Jesusa community of grace living out the purpose and personality of Jesus in our world. It is in relationships that others see Christ. But how do we do this in a world filled with strife and conflictconflict in our marriages, our friendships, our churchesconflicts with God and conflicts within (shame, depression, fear)? Tara Barthel and Judy Dabler do an incredible job of showing us that we are called to be peacemaking women and we become true peacemakers through repentance, faith and rightful worship of God alone. This book does not give A-B-Cs to becoming a happy and peaceful woman. The authors are quick to admit that the journey to becoming a peacemaking woman is not an easy one, but it is possible. The book is full of scripture, scripture-based prayers and an extensive list of resources for further study. The discussion questions are not like the typical fluff that you find in many booksthey encourage you to dig deep. Tara and Judy are more transparent than most authors and have already encouraged me to be more transparent myself. These ladies have worked through some tough conflicts themselves and are quick to share the lessons they have learned. The chapter on Female Leaders with Strong Personalities was perhaps the best I have read on the subject. This is not a book you read once and then put it on your shelf. Even though I had a hard time putting it down, I found myself needing to stop and reflect on an illustration, statement or Biblical reference. This is a book that I will turn to again and again and will share with others. I have already given it to several friends and am planning discussion groups around it in our church. I wish it had been around 20 years ago! Thank you for sharing your hearts, Tara and Judy!
